
Synopsis
Long, long ago, at the foot of the high mountains, lived a brother and sister. They lived in harmony, worked hard, but at the end of each day, they always found time to sing their favorite song. The sister especially loved to sing. All the local villagers loved the songs of this heroine — all except one cunning villain.
